On-device AI

On-device transcription for Windows

PrivaSpeech runs speech recognition directly on your Windows PC using Parakeet V3 AI models. Your voice is processed locally, not on remote servers.

How it works
  • AI model runs on your CPU
  • Audio stays on your machine
  • Works offline after setup
  • No audio sent to third parties

Cloud-based (typical services)

  • Audio streamed to remote servers
  • Processing happens in data centers
  • Requires constant internet
  • Data retention policies vary

Technology

Uses NVIDIA's Parakeet V3 model optimized for local inference via the ONNX runtime.

Hardware

Works on modern CPUs without a dedicated GPU.

Privacy

After the initial model download, transcription doesn't require internet connectivity.

~465MB download, stored locally on your PC

ONNX Runtime with CPU support

English (general vocabulary)

Windows 10/11, 64-bit

When speech recognition happens on your device, you control where your audio goes. There's no need to trust a third party with potentially sensitive recordings.

On-device processing also means lower latency (no network round-trip) and reliable operation even when internet is unavailable.

The tradeoff: on-device models may be less accurate than the largest cloud models for specialized vocabulary. For most dictation tasks, the difference is manageable with light edits.
